ABSTRACT:
An electric field having a strength of approximately 15 V
m is applied between a tungsten tip and a metallic substrate. Concomitantly, the tip is heated to a temperature less than the bulk melting temperature of the tungsten tip. Atoms at the surface of the tip move and form a pyramidal protrusion of nanometer scale on the tip. Topmost atoms on the protrusion are charged and form a coherent beam useful for writing atomic scale structures on the substrate.
